Why UPVC Windows and Doors Are Ideal For Your Home

Upvc windows and doors are a great way to boost your home's overall energy efficiency. They are strong and durable, and require low maintenance. These attributes make them perfect for any home.

Durability

UPVC windows and doors are extremely tough. They offer a safe environment and enhance the appearance of your home. They will not need to be concerned about costly repairs, painting, or maintenance for many years. These products are able to last for over 25 years.

uPVC is a durable and affordable material that is both affordable and effective. It is chemical-proof, weatherproof, and resistant to termites and humidity. It is also easy to maintain. It is easy to clean by using soap and water.

Compared to wooden doors, UPVC doors are more stable, durable, and weather-resistant. UPVC windows are also extremely effective in terms of sound-dissipation. It is also resistant to corrosion and fire.

UPVC is also extremely eco-friendly. This allows you to help reduce the impact on the environment as well as your energy bills. Aside from that, uPVC has a long life span and requires very little maintenance.

Energy efficiency

If you're looking to improve your energy efficiency, uPVC windows and doors can be a great choice. They help keep your home cool in summer and warmer in winter, saving you money on electricity bills. They are also durable and can withstand a range of chemicals.

Low maintenance

If you choose to buy a uPVC door or window, you are sure to get the most value for your investment. It's durable and easy to maintain. In addition, UPVC windows are more affordable than wooden doors.

It is important to ensure that your uPVC doors and windows are kept in good condition. Not only will this prolong the life of your windows but it will also improve their effectiveness. To maximize the value of your investment, follow these simple guidelines for maintenance.

To clean the glass of your uPVC doors, you must first clean it with a damp cloth. Make sure to apply a mild liquid detergent. This is the most effective method of cleaning UPVC. After it has dried clean it, polish it.

Spray oil can be used to lubricate moving parts of your uPVC doors. This is to be done every couple of months. It is crucial to apply the silicone evenly spray. You can also clean hinges using silicone spray.

Cost

You might be interested in the cost of replacing your windows. Depending on the dimensions and style of the windows, the cost could be substantial. It is important to consider every aspect before purchasing replacement windows.

uPVC windows are the most sought-after option in the UK. They are also environmentally friendly. They can help reduce energy bills and noise. UPVC is also resistant to damp, rot, and pollution. They are much more cost-effective than aluminium or wooden frames and require less maintenance.

A replacement set of ten windows will cost you between $8000 to $12,000 depending on the kind and number of windows. It's about PS2,800 for a set of six windows.

UPVC windows typically last for at least three decades and certain uPVC windows have a steel core. These kinds of windows can be constructed from gray shades that are becoming more popular. Gray shades can cost 10-25 percent more than white uPVC frames.
